Job description

Overview

Full time 36 hours/week | 9:00am - 5:30pm Mon-Fri

The Patient Care Assistant (PCA) provides direct patient care and supportive services under the supervision of a Registered Nurse (RN). The PCA assists in delivering safe, effective, patient-centered care while ensuring a clean, orderly environment and demonstrating service excellence behaviors to promote patient and family satisfaction.

Qualifications

Age of Patients Served: All Age Groups

Required Education: High School Diploma or GED

Necessary Skills

  • Demonstrates teamwork and communicates in a professional manner with all of the healthcare team.
  • Demonstrates the ability to learn and apply all hospital computer technologies and procedures that affect patient care delivery.
  • Knowledge of basic medical terminology and standard precautions, ability to read/write in English, etc.

Required Licensure/Certifications

-Basic Life Support (BLS) Certification

-Crisis Prevention Institute training within 90 days of hire or transfer and then annually is required for the Psychiatric unit only.

Preferred Licensure/Certifications: N/A

Required Experience: Less than one year

Preferred Experience: N/A Preferred Education: N/A
